They max out at about 4 1/2" inches. I believe the largest one ever found had a shell length of about 5 inches. My turtles is over twice as big as the picture I posted above. I took that photo in March I think. They are a great turtles species to keep because they stay so small.

In my state (PA.), pet stores can get away with selling baby turtles under 4" inches if they are for "scientific study" or "research."
